What is a Real Gore Website?

Alright, let’s start with the basics. A real gore website is an online platform where users can find videos and images of extreme violence, accidents, or even deaths. These sites are often hosted on the dark web, making them difficult to access without specific tools like Tor browsers. The content on these platforms is raw, unfiltered, and sometimes even illegal to distribute.

But here’s the thing: not all gore websites are created equal. Some focus on accidents and injuries, while others dive into darker themes like murder or torture. The level of graphicness varies from site to site, but one thing’s for sure—they’re not for the weak-stomached.

A Brief History of Real Gore Websites

Believe it or not, real gore websites have been around for longer than you think. Back in the early days of the internet, these platforms were small, niche communities where enthusiasts shared content. As technology advanced and the internet became more accessible, these sites grew in popularity.

One of the earliest known gore websites was “The Well of Souls,” which emerged in the late 1990s. It was a place where users could find all kinds of bizarre and graphic content. Over the years, these sites evolved, moving from public forums to the dark web to avoid legal repercussions.

The Impact on Society and Mental Health

Now, let’s talk about the bigger picture. How do real gore websites affect society as a whole? On one hand, they provide a platform for people to explore their curiosity in a controlled environment. On the other hand, they can desensitize viewers to violence and perpetuate harmful behaviors.

Studies have shown that prolonged exposure to violent content can lead to increased aggression, anxiety, and depression. It can also affect your ability to empathize with others, which is a crucial part of being a functioning member of society.
